Safety Profile of Acid Reflux Treatments

Understanding PPI Safety

Proton pump inhibitors, including omeprazole, lansoprazole, and pantoprazole, have been extensively studied and are generally considered safe for most people when used appropriately. These medications work by blocking acid production in the stomach, providing effective relief from acid reflux symptoms. The safety profile of PPIs has been established through decades of clinical use and research, with millions of people worldwide benefiting from these treatments.

Common Side Effects and Their Frequency

Most people tolerate acid reflux medications well, but some may experience side effects. Common side effects affecting up to 1 in 10 people include headache, stomach pain, constipation, diarrhoea, and feeling sick. These effects are typically mild and often resolve as your body adjusts to the medication. Wind and feeling dizzy may also occur but are less common. It's important to note that experiencing side effects doesn't necessarily mean you should stop treatment, but you should discuss any concerns with your healthcare provider.

Long-term Safety Considerations

Extended use of PPIs requires careful consideration and monitoring. Some studies have suggested potential associations with long-term use, including reduced absorption of certain vitamins and minerals, particularly vitamin B12, magnesium, and calcium. Additionally, there may be a slightly increased risk of bone fractures with prolonged use, particularly in older adults. However, these risks must be weighed against the benefits of treating acid reflux, as untreated reflux can lead to serious complications including oesophageal damage.

Drug Interactions and Contraindications

PPIs can interact with certain medications, affecting how they work or increasing the risk of side effects. Notable interactions include blood-thinning medications like warfarin, HIV medications, and some antifungal treatments. People with severe liver problems may need dose adjustments or alternative treatments. It's crucial to inform your healthcare provider about all medications you're taking, including over-the-counter medicines and supplements.

Monitoring and Follow-up

Regular review of acid reflux treatment is essential for maintaining safety and effectiveness. Healthcare providers typically recommend reassessing treatment after 4-8 weeks of initial therapy and periodically thereafter for long-term users. This monitoring helps ensure the lowest effective dose is used and allows for early detection of any potential issues. Patients should report persistent symptoms, new side effects, or concerns about their treatment promptly.
